Cracked Sidewalk Repair in Des Moines, IA
Cracked sidewalk repair services address issues caused by natural settling, temperature fluctuations, and ground movement that can lead to uneven or damaged concrete surfaces. These repairs typically involve filling cracks, removing and replacing severely damaged sections, or leveling uneven slabs to restore safety and appearance. Property owners often seek this service to prevent further deterioration, improve curb appeal, and ensure safe passage across walkways, especially in residential areas where cracks can become tripping hazards.
Before requesting cracked sidewalk repair,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the damage, including whether cracks are superficial or indicate deeper structural issues. It’s also helpful to know the types of repair methods available and how they can match the existing sidewalk. Clarifying the scope of work, materials used, and the expected outcome can assist in making informed decisions and ensuring the repairs meet safety and aesthetic expectations.

Common Cracked Sidewalk Repair Jobs
Cracked Sidewalk Repair - Restores safety and improves curb appeal by fixing uneven or broken concrete.
Sidewalk Leveling - Addresses sinking or settling slabs to create a smooth, even walking surface.
Crack Filling - Seals small cracks to prevent water infiltration and further deterioration.
Concrete Replacement - Replaces severely damaged sections to ensure stability and longevity.
Trip Hazard Removal - Eliminates uneven areas that pose safety risks for pedestrians.
Surface Resurfacing - Revives worn or stained sidewalks with a fresh, durable finish.
Cracked Sidewalk Repair Questions
What causes sidewalks to crack? Cracks often result from ground shifting, temperature changes, or soil settling beneath the concrete.
Is cracked sidewalk repair necessary? Yes, repairing cracks helps prevent further damage and maintains safety and curb appeal.
What types of repairs are common for cracked sidewalks? Common methods include filling cracks, slab leveling, and replacing severely damaged sections.
How can property owners prevent future sidewalk damage? Proper drainage, regular inspections, and timely repairs can help reduce the risk of new cracks forming.
